What is the Homeowner Authorization Agreement for Direct Payments?

The Homeowner Authorization Agreement for Direct Payments is a vital document that allows homeowners to authorize their homeowners association to automatically debit their checking account for monthly assessments. This form collects important information such as homeowner details, bank information, and the required consent for direct payments. Understanding this agreement is essential for any homeowner looking to streamline their payment processes.

Purpose and Benefits of Using the Homeowner Authorization Agreement

This agreement offers several advantages for homeowners. Primarily, it enhances efficiency by enabling automatic payments of homeowners association fees, thereby simplifying the payment process. Additionally, using this form helps homeowners avoid late fees, allowing for better management of their monthly assessments.

Key Features of the Homeowner Authorization Agreement

The Homeowner Authorization Agreement includes several essential sections.
  • Homeowner contact information.
  • Bank details required for ACH transactions.
  • Signature field for authorization consent.
Importantly, the agreement contains a warning about potential fees for returned payments and outlines provisions for terminating the authorization.

Who Should Use the Homeowner Authorization Agreement for Direct Payments?

This form is designed for homeowners who are part of a homeowners association and need to make regular payments. Eligibility typically includes ownership of property within the HOA, making this agreement particularly relevant for those who wish to facilitate consistent payment of their dues.
